Quick Answer
The answer is to use CloudWatch Logs Insights or export logs to Amazon S3 and query with Amazon Athena. CloudWatch Logs Insights is purpose-built for searching across multiple CloudWatch log groups for error patterns using its own query language, allowing you to filter, aggregate, and visualize log events without moving data. The export-to-S3-and-Athena option is equally valid because Athena can run SQL queries over the exported log files in S3, making it ideal for large-scale or complex pattern analysis. On the AWS Certified DevOps Engineer Professional DOP-C02 exam, this question tests your ability to distinguish native cross-log-group query tools from single-log-group features like filter patterns or subscription filters. A common trap is choosing CloudWatch Logs filter patterns, which only work within one log group at a time. Detailed technical explanation
How to think about this question
CloudWatch Logs Insights uses a query engine that automatically indexes log events by timestamp and supports operations like stats, sort, and filter across up to 20 log groups per query. Under the hood, it leverages a distributed query execution model that scans log data in parallel, providing results in seconds even for terabytes of logs. In contrast, exporting logs to S3 and querying with Athena is a cost-effective approach for large-scale historical analysis, but introduces latency due to export delays and requires managing S3 storage and Athena table schemas.
